Output 89c842488025cb53ebef2c0db562537e712dcc8653460e20bd5a2debb2dd2867:2

value
98990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9536e5acd593d5bbb722bd314365f4fa14752793 OP_EQUAL
address
3FHzNSyRLEWurk8eCxQ1voNH4CcQeB539X
transaction
89c842488025cb53ebef2c0db562537e712dcc8653460e20bd5a2debb2dd2867
spent
true